7 Reasons Why You Need a Mentor

No matter where your career path takes you, making the journey on your own can be a daunting prospect.  

In an environment as agile and evolutionary as technology, the path to success is always changing, with new updates and innovations happening all the time. Having someone alongside you to help you over the hurdles you’ll face in the pursuit of your ideal career is a powerful way to stay strong, confident, and motivated.  

A great mentor is more than just a leader in the technology space; they’re a source of motivation, drive, and development. Mentors help you to build your connections, expand your mind, and discover new skills. These are the people who never let you settle for just “getting by” at work. With a mentor, you discover your true potential.  

Here are just seven reasons why you need a mentor in your life.  

 

1. Mentors Provide Expertise

Whether you’re a Salesforce superstar or a data analyst in training, we all face challenges on the road to success. One of the best ways to overcome these hiccups is to speak to someone who has been down the same path.  

Mentors have already been where you are now. They’ve made the mistakes you’re concerned about making, and they know how to offer advice that will help you to avoid them. A great, and well-connected mentor might even be familiar with the latest software and tools you’re using in your role, which means they can answer any questions you have.  

 

2. Mentors See Opportunity for Growth

Assessing your skills isn’t easy. It’s difficult to be objective when you’re listing strengths and weaknesses in your CV, which is why so many people have trouble working out where they need to grow.  

Fortunately, a mentor can analyse your potential for you, and spot opportunities for development that you might have missed. For instance, if you’re a marketing employee, your mentor might suggest working on your knowledge of AI and analytics, even if you never considered taking that path with your career. They can see the routes that will lead you to the best results, which makes them a great compass for your professional life.  

 

3. Mentors Motivate You

The road to success isn’t always an easy one to travel. Even the most passionate team members find themselves feeling uninspired at times. For instance, you might make a mistake in your big data career, or struggle to understand blockchain and tell yourself that you’re simply not right for the role you’ve been striving for.  

A mentor won’t try to convince you that you’re ready for a position that you can’t handle. However, they will give you the motivation to keep moving forward when the going gets tough. Mentors remind us that we all make mistakes – often by sharing their own experiences. As Oprah Winfrey told the world: ” A mentor is someone who allows you to see the hope inside yourself.” 

Sometimes we all need a cheerleader, and a mentor can be that for you.  

 

4. Mentors Challenge You to Go Further

While support is important for any ambitious employee, sometimes what we really need is a little push.  

There are times when it’s tempting to simply sit back and rest on your laurels in a career – particularly when you feel comfortable in your current role. However, a mentor is there to help you see your true potential and push you to reach it.  

Mentors are leaders at heart, which means that they inspire, advise and even challenge you when necessary. They celebrate your successes with you, help you learn from your failures, and remind you that the only way to succeed is to keep pushing forward. This might mean encouraging you to take a new marketing automation course, learn how to use a new HCM system, or apply for a promotion at work.  

5. Mentors Offer Honest Advice

One of the biggest assets of a great mentor is their experience. , They know how to help you overcome the obstacles you will face as you develop your career.  

When you’re unsure which path to take, a mentor can assess all the variables from an unbiased perspective and give you their honest advice. At times when you need to make decisions for yourself, such as whether to take a job in blockchain or continue your career in data analytics, mentors can act as a sounding board as you work through your options.  

 

6. Mentors Make Connections

Another positive side effect of a mentor’s experience in your field is their network. Many of the best mentors have spent years building connections with industry experts and peers that can open doors in your future. 

Sometimes who you know can be just as important as what you know in the technology industry. Mentors can provide access to people in your industry that are willing to invest in you, offer additional training, or even introduce you to new career opportunities.  

 

7. Mentors Prepare you For Change

Currently, the world of technology is in a state of flux thanks to the arrival of the fourth industrial revolution. However, this isn’t the first time that people in this sector have had to deal with change. The tech space has been growing and evolving for decades, which means any mentor you connect with will know first-hand how to deal with transformation.  

A mentor can coach you to cope with the current and impending changes in your space and ensure that you’re always ahead of the curve. Mentors teach you how to build the right connections in your HCM career, take the right training opportunities in big data, and adapt your automation strategies so that you’re always on the cutting edge of the industry.
